Biography

Tristan Campbell completed his Bachelor of Science degree in Geophysics in 2001 and spent 15 years in the industry focusing on groundwater and engineering environmental projects. He initially worked with a startup that grew to become the largest near-surface geophysics business in Australia. His industry experience allowed him to engage with the latest developments in the field, including 4D electrical resistivity, passive seismic methods, and 3D ground penetrating radar. Concurrently, he began beekeeping, which led to the pursuit of his PhD in Applied Physics, focusing on remote sensing to predict honey harvests. He received his doctorate in 2020, with research aimed at applying spatial data science skills and machine learning in ecological projects. His research interests include data quality and analytical rigor in ecological science, emphasizing the increasing availability of remote sensing data and potential biases in interpreting these data for ecological modeling. He is dedicated to validating the quality of findings through raw data analysis to uncover fundamental relationships within the data.
